- The distance between Clinton, Ia, Usa and Hohenpeißenberg, Bavaria, Germany is approximately 7,383 km or 4,588 mi.
- To reach Clinton, Ia in this distance one would set out from Hohenpeißenberg, Bavaria bearing 307.2°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Clinton, Ia bearing 226° or SW .
- Clinton, Ia has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Hohenpeißenberg, Bavaria has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Clinton, Ia is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Hohenpeißenberg, Bavaria is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ome.
- The average temperature is 3.6 °C (6.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.8 °C (24.8°F) more in Clinton, Ia.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 316.8 mm (12.5 in) less which is equivalent to 316.8 l/m² (7.78 US gal/ft²) or 3,168,000 l/ha (338,680 US gal/ac) less. About 3/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.8° higher in Clinton, Ia than in Hohenpeißenberg, Bavaria.
